    Description

    Ambrosia Energy is on a mission to make solar + battery systems the fastest-to-deploy and most cost-effective energy source in the US and beyond. As global energy demand surges—driven by the rapid rise of data centers, electric vehicles, and future in-home robotics—the world stands at a critical energy inflection point. To meet this challenge, we need innovative, scalable power sources. Our engineering-led team, with expertise in designing and deploying satellite constellations (Swarm, Starlink Mobile), is now focused on energy on Earth. We're developing affordable, clean energy solutions with new battery storage systems. United by strong team camaraderie, we prioritize speed, rapid iteration, vertical integration, and a test-like-you-fly approach. We're committed to making an impact on the future of energy.

    We are designing and developing a distributed battery storage system to pair with solar panels that are quick and easy to install. The system is simple, robust, reliable, and easy to manufacture at scale. The system will include highly efficient DC-DC conversion, solar MPPT, power distribution, no moving parts, and efficient cable management to make everything plug and play in the field.

    Responsibilities

    • Build and test battery packs including wiring, installing electrical components and mechanical components, potting, etc.

    • Operate laser welding machine.

    • Perform automated tests of battery health.

    • Operate forklift, pallet jack, and other heavy equipment.

    • Operate production machinery and equipment safely while ensuring quality builds.

    • Assemble battery systems on a manufacturing production line, following detailed build instructions.

    • Perform visual inspections of parts and finished packs to identify defects or issues.

    • Load and unload materials onto the production line and assist with building job kits and organizing components and tools.

    •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e workstation.

    • Identify opportunities to improve assembly processes and communicate suggestions to the broader team.

    Qualifications

    • 1+ years of professional experience in a related field with electronics or mechanical assembly.

    • Hands-on experience with building, debugging, testing, and validating electrical systems using oscilloscopes, multimeters, and similar tools. Experience with common hand and power tools.

    • Prior experience in manufacturing, assembly, construction, or a warehouse environment is preferred.

    • Ability to stand or walk for the duration of a shift and lift 50 lbs.

    • A strong sense of reliability, with a work ethic that supports keeping the production line moving.

    • Extreme attention to detail and the ability to follow written and verbal instructions in English.

    Preferred Skills or Experience

    • Familiarity with solar arrays as input power sources.

    • Familiarity with lithium-ion battery handling, safety, and usage.
